I Tesori delle chiese di Petralia Soprana

2016

Il volume è dedicato ai monili, alle suppellettili liturgiche in argento e ai parati sacri conservati nei Tesori delle chiese di Petralia Soprana, centro delle alte Madonie appartenente alla Diocesi di Cefalù. Le opere esaminate si rivelano del tutto originali poiché permettono di inoltrarsi in un periodo della storia dell’arte in Sicilia che va dal Trecento all’Ottocento. Le suppellettili liturgiche, commissionate da prelati, nobili e fedeli, sono state realizzate da argentieri messinesi, catanesi e soprattutto palermitani. Experimental BIM applications in Archaeology: a work-flow

2014

In the last few decades various conceptual models, methods and techniques have been studied to allow 3D digital access to Cultural Heritage (CH). Among these is BIM (Building Information Modeling): originally built up for construction projects, it has been already experimented in the CH domain, but not enough in the archaeological field. This paper illustrates a framework to create 3D archaeological models integrated with databases using BIM. The models implemented are queryable by the connection with a Relational Database Management System and sharable on the web. A reflective characterisation of occasional user

2017

This work revisits established user classifications and aims to characterise a historically unspecified user category, the Occasional User (OU). Three user categories, novice, intermediate and expert, have dominated the work of user interface (UI) designers, researchers and educators for decades. These categories were created to conceptualise user's needs, strategies and goals around the 80s. Since then, UI paradigm shifts, such as direct manipulation and touch, along with other advances in technology, gave new access to people with little computer knowledge.
